About The Book

When the wind whisks away her late grandfather’s scarf, a child runs after it, passing through places that remind her of her grandfather, in this moving, gorgeously illustrated debut picture book perfect for fans of The Memory Box and The Remember Balloons.

Warm and beautiful, Lan’s red scarf once belonged to her grandfather, Lao Ye. But on the first day of snow, a sudden gust of wind takes the scarf away. Now Lan must catch it in a desperate chase through the city that leads her past places filled with memories of Lao Ye. Lan runs fast, but can she outrun the wind?

About The Author

Siyang Lim is a picture book author and illustrator based in Brooklyn. Born and raised in China, she moved to the United States at the age of sixteen. Her works draw inspiration from moments of daily life and childhood memories. She enjoys exploring different methods and mediums to bring her visions to life, and she loves creating whimsical and playful creatures from imagination, as well as telling emotional and personal stories that connect all of us. The Red Scarf is her debut picture book.
